Sure...it will probably bolt right on, but if you want it to match up properly, you're going to have to swap a LOT more than just the front end - the Navigator has different side trim that starts at the front end, and continues completely around the vehicle. Not to mention the hood, bumper, fenders, etc. I wouldn't do it. It'd be less expensive and alot less trouble just to buy a Navigator if you want that look.
